Solana Company (HSDT) rolled out a strategic roadmap to invest in a new low-latency cluster in Asia Pacific to drive staking and validation with the focus on supporting Solana’s ecosystem building and diversifying revenue streams for Solana Company. The significant new infrastructure investment, which will start with connecting Seoul, Tokyo, Singapore, and Hong Kong, is designed to help address the significant gap in Solana’s network in the region despite the fact that the majority of the global population and crypto users, and substantial wealth are located there. The region also has significant share of global financial transactions especially in cross-border payments and trading. Solana Company plans to begin building out the network infrastructure immediately, expanding to optimizing performance and adopting new technologies by the second half of 2026, and anticipates launching liquidity related new products and services within the next 12 to 18 months. Specifically, Solana Company will focus on addressing the needs of market makers, high-frequency traders as well as other Solana partners. The strategic roadmap will begin by activating a series of smaller nodes to ensure security and efficiency and then scale from there. The plan includes implementing state-of-the-art hardware and potentially capturing more value within the staking business.
